THE EFFECTS OF CONTEXT TYPE IN DISAMBIGUATING RELATIVE CLAUSES IN TURKISH

Abstract :By examining the processing difficulties incurred by relative clause ambiguities, significant findings are derived on how sentence processor works. The goal of the present study is to understand the effect of context types in relative clause attachment in Turkish. The situational and linguistic contexts are manipulated to observe if attachment preference differs in neutral and context-dependent settings via off-line and on-line tasks. The results reveal that NP1 preference observed in neutral contexts transforms into NP2 when both types of contexts bias NP2. Comparing the context types, the findings further suggest that linguistic context is more effective than situational context.
